An Introduction to Robot Learning and Isaac Lab#
About this Course#
Robot learning is revolutionizing how machines interact with their environments, but have you ever wondered what robot learning really is? This overview will explore the fundamentals of robot learning and introduce NVIDIA’s Isaac Lab, a powerful tool for developing robotic applications.
By the end, you will understand the basics of robot learning, Isaac Lab’s key features, and how this framework fits into the broader robotics landscape. We’ll explore available robots and environments within Isaac Lab, as well as peek at the product roadmap.
Learning Objectives#
In this course, we will:
Explore the fundamentals of robot learning and the algorithms that drive it.
Discover how Isaac Lab fits into the Isaac Sim ecosystem and its core functionalities.
Identify potential applications and customer bases for Isaac Lab.
Dive into the processes for designing environments, from asset import to policy deployment.
Understand workflows for transitioning simulations to real-world applications.
By the end, you will understand the basics of robot learning, Isaac Lab’s key features, and how this framework fits into the broader robotics landscape. We’ll explore available robots and environments within Isaac Lab, as well as peek at the product roadmap.
But first, let’s ask the question: what is robot learning?